Job Description
Analytics Consultant
Northampton (Hybrid – 2x Days a Week in Office)
£65,000-£75,000
THE COMPANY
A retail banking giant is seeking Analytics Consultants to join the team and work on projects across customer, product & risk analytics!
THE ROLE
As the Analytics Consultant, you will use your cross-functional analytics expertise to support different business units. You will get the opportunity to work across projects in the customer/insight analytics, product & credit risk space. You will be comfortable being a technical analytics SME and also comfortable working with cross-functional stakeholders across the bank!
YOUR SKILLS AND EXPERIENCE
- Strong experience in the customer/insight/product analytics space
- Strong stakeholder management / engagement experience

StudySmarter Expert Advice 🤫
We think this is how you could land Analytics Consultant
✨Tip Number 1
Familiarize yourself with the latest trends in data analytics and retail banking. This will not only help you understand the industry better but also allow you to speak confidently about how your skills can contribute to the company's goals during the interview.
✨Tip Number 2
Network with current or former employees of the company on platforms like LinkedIn. Engaging with them can provide you with insider knowledge about the company culture and expectations, which can be invaluable during your application process.
✨Tip Number 3
Prepare specific examples from your past experiences where you've successfully used SQL and Python to drive insights. Being able to articulate these examples clearly will demonstrate your technical proficiency and problem-solving abilities.
✨Tip Number 4
Research the key stakeholders within the organization and understand their roles. This will help you tailor your discussions during interviews, showing that you are proactive and genuinely interested in how you can support various departments.
